In exercise physiology studies it is sometimes important to determine the location of a person's center of mass. This can be done with the arrangement shown in the figure. A light plank rests on two scales, which give reading of Fg1 = 390 N and Fg2 = 310 N. The scales are separated by a distance of 2.00 m. How far from the woman's feet is her center of mass?
